Located on the edge of the historic city of Exeter, Digby & Sowton train station serves as a convenient gateway for both commuters and explorers venturing into one of the UK's most picturesque regions. Though it may not boast the grandeur of larger stations, Digby & Sowton offers a blend of essential amenities and excellent transport links that make it a practical choice for many travelers.
While Digby & Sowton station may not have a ticket office, it provides easy access to ticket machines for quick pass retrieval. The station supports accessibility with step-free access throughout. For those requiring assistance, a help point is available, and customer support can be reached through GWR’s online services or social media. Additionally, the station features CCTV for enhanced security.
Among the features that cater to passenger convenience, there is a free car park with 21 spaces open 24 hours a day. Cyclists can make use of 20 bike storage spots, although shelter is not available. However, if you’re looking for a bite or a caffeine fix, you might need to plan ahead as there are no refreshment facilities or shops on the premises, nor are there ATMs available.
Digby & Sowton ensures smooth transit for passengers with reduced mobility. Ramps make for straightforward platform access, although there are no staff-assisted services on-site—help can be arranged in advance through Passenger Assist. The lack of waiting rooms and accessible toilets may be a drawback for some, but seating is available.
One of the advantages of this station is its integration with local transport. There's a bus service that connects directly through the station forecourt. You can download more detailed travel plans from here for your convenience.
For those concerned about rail disruptions, the station provides a rail replacement service, ensuring continuity in travel plans through its location over the station footbridge.

While Wimbledon Chase Station does not boast extensive facilities, it is equipped with essential amenities to ensure a smooth travel experience. Notably, you’ll find accessible ticket machines which cater to customers with Disabled Persons Railcard discounts, making ticket purchasing a breeze. However, it is important to plan accordingly as the station lacks a staffed ticket office and has no dedicated waiting rooms or refreshment facilities. CCTV surveillance provides an added layer of security.
Accessibility might pose a challenge here, as the station is categorized under 'Category C', indicating no step-free access. This means that travelers with mobility impairments may want to prepare for limited accessibility options. While you won't find use of ramps or accessible toilets, assistance can be arranged through various help points and a responsive helpline for those who preregister their travel needs.
Connectivity doesn't stop at the train lines—Wimbledon Chase offers various onward travel options. While there is no direct taxi or car hire services at the station, seamlessly transitioning from train to local bus services is facilitated by the Onward Travel Information Map, which helps you plan subsequent journeys. Moreover, the area’s bus services expand your reach to different districts, enhancing convenience for daily commuters and adventurers seeking new destinations.
